Anal. of isomeric ribomononucleotides by pos.-ion fast atom bombardment tandem mass spectrometry is described. Daughter ion spectra generated by collision-induced dissociation-mass-analyzed ion kinetic energy scanning on a sector instrument are compared with daughter ion spectra from a triple quadrupole mass spectrometer, and criteria are established for the differentiation of th 2′,3′- and 5′-monophosphate isomers of adenosine, guanosine and cytosine, based on their characteristic fragmentation patterns. The value of tandem mass spectrometry in the identification of nucleotides extracted from biol. systems and isolated by HPLC and in the study of nucleotide metabolism is discussed.
